Wedding Guest Shuttle Buses Between Redwood City Hotels and Venues
Coordinating guests between hotel blocks and your ceremony venue is one of the most stressful logistics puzzles of any wedding weekend — especially when your guests are spread across properties on El Camino Real, near the Caltrain station, or up by the Woodside Road corridor. A dedicated guest shuttle bus solves all of it. Your guests board at the hotel, arrive together, and never have to hunt for street parking in downtown Redwood City or figure out the Caltrain schedule on their own.
Popular ceremony and reception venues like Fox Theatre (2221 Broadway Street, Redwood City, CA 94063) and outdoor spaces near Edgewood Park sit close to residential streets where parking is limited on weekends. A 25- to 35-passenger minibus runs a clean loop between your hotel block and the venue entrance, keeping your timeline tight and your guests happy. Redwood City's Jefferson and Marshall garages provide the first 1.5 hours free, while downtown-core meters are $1 per hour Monday–Saturday from 8 a.m. to 8 p.m. and Broadway has a 2-hour limit, giving guests a concrete backup to street parking.
The Fox Theatre also prohibits outside food and drink, including water, and subjects people and bags to search, so leave coolers and restricted items behind. Confirm drop-off access with your venue coordinator before the wedding day, and check the city's Redwood City parking and transportation page for current street restrictions near downtown.

Airport Transfer Buses for Redwood City Wedding Guests Flying Into SFO
Out-of-town guests flying into San Francisco International Airport (SFO) (780 S Airport Blvd, San Francisco, CA 94128) face a straightforward but surprisingly stressful journey — ground transportation from the terminal, a 20- to 35-minute run south on US-101 depending on traffic, and then finding their hotel in an unfamiliar city. On a Friday afternoon before a Saturday wedding, US-101 through South San Francisco and San Bruno can slow to a crawl, and rideshare surge pricing spikes right when your guests need a ride most.
A pre-arranged airport shuttle bus in Redwood City uses SFO's charter pickup and drop-off areas in the courtyards on the Arrivals/Baggage Claim Level, and SFO says charter service must be pre-arranged, so your group needs a confirmed meeting point rather than a general terminal curb. How far in advance should I book wedding transportation in Redwood City?
For Saturday weddings between May and October — peak season on the San Francisco Peninsula — book your wedding bus rental at least four to six months out. Bay Area wedding season fills transportation calendars fast, especially for popular June and September dates when multiple weddings compete for the same vehicles across San Mateo and Santa Clara counties. Waiting until the last two months usually means premium pricing and limited vehicle selection.

Can a charter bus pick up wedding guests at SFO and bring them to Redwood City?
Yes — a charter bus or minibus can pick up your group at San Francisco International Airport (780 S Airport Blvd, San Francisco, CA 94128) in SFO's charter pickup courtyards on the Arrivals/Baggage Claim Level and run them directly to your hotel block or venue in Redwood City. Charter service must be pre-arranged with the service operator, so confirm the exact courtyard meeting point with SFO's ground transportation team ahead of time. A direct airport transfer is far smoother than asking out-of-town guests to coordinate rideshares on their own after a long flight.
